Norsk glas fra 1750'erne - Nøstetangen Øvrige porcelænsvarer The bird's decoration was designedHeight 17 cm. Beautiful drinking glass from Norwegian Nsteangen with engraved crown and monogram. The glass is slightly yellowish, which indicates an age from 1750 and a few years later, when Nsteangen's well known grayish glass mass was developed. The glass has fine lines from the glassmaker's tool, a fine bend at the bottom and a bent foot. There is a blown air bead in the stem. It is engraved with the monogram "LH" under a crown.
